First, let’s talk about the firsts!  In the past month or so we had the following items installed in our rig.  1.  A Residential Refrigerator, 2.  Easy Start units on both A/Cs. 3. JT Strong Arm stabilizers, 4. Splendide Combination Washer/Dryer, 5. Custom built shelving in the front Master Bedroom Closet, 6. A Berkey Water Filter, 7. Battery Operated Motion Sensing Lights for the inside stairs and ½ bath,  and 8.  LCI SolidStep entry stairs.  Everything worked well and we are glad we made the choices.
